Post by Rogg » Tue Jun 20, 2023 8:35 am

https://www.pdc.tv/news/2023/06/19/reig ... ts-masters


NZ Darts Masters
August 4-5, GLOBOX Arena, Hamilton

PDC Representatives

Michael Smith
Peter Wright
Gerwyn Price
Rob Cross
Jonny Clayton
Danny Noppert
Nathan Aspinall
Dimitri Van den Bergh

Oceanic Representatives
Damon Heta
Simon Whitlock
Ben Robb - DPNZ Number One
Haupai Puha - DPNZ Number Two
DPNZ Q1 - July 1, Christchurch
DPNZ Q2 - July 2, Christchurch
Top-Ranked player on DPNZ Order of Merit on July 2 following DPNZ Qualifiers
DPA Qualifier - Top-Ranked player following Event 21 (July 9)

---

PalmerBet NSW Darts Masters
August 11-12, WIN Entertainment Centre, Wollongong

PDC Representatives

Michael Smith
Peter Wright
Gerwyn Price
Rob Cross
Jonny Clayton
Danny Noppert
Nathan Aspinall
Dimitri Van den Bergh

Oceanic Representatives
Damon Heta
Simon Whitlock
DPA Q1 - Mal Cuming
DPA Q2 - Darren Penhall
DPA Q3 - Dave Marland
DPA Q4 - July 7, Warilla
DPNZ Qualifier - July 1, Christchurch
Top-ranked player from DPA Order of Merit following Event 21 (July 9)
